Banff Weather in June
Banff in June sees moderate temperatures, with highs around 13°C (55°F) and overnight lows of 1°C (34°F). Rainfall is at its peak this month, around 130 mm (5.1 in) on average, so waterproofs are essential.
Rainfall in Banff in June
Expect frequent showers this month, so make sure to have an umbrella to keep yourself dry. You can expect rain on roughly 13 days based on historical data, averaging 130 mm (5.1 in) for the month. When it rains this month, it tends to come down fairly heavily. Showers can be substantial even if they don't last all day.
Temperature in Banff in June
In June, Banff gets moderate temperatures, with highs of 13°C (55°F). Nights cool to around 1°C (34°F). The summer season takes place during June. A light jacket or extra layer can be useful, especially outside the warmest hours of the day. Nights fall to 1°C (34°F), which is cold enough to feel it indoors too. Sunshine in Banff in June
Expect sunny days throughout the month, with an estimated 209 hours of sunshine. Banff historical weather extremes in June
According to our 50 years of weather records for Banff, the following extremes were recorded between 1976 and 2026.
- Banff experienced its chilliest June day on June 6, 1982, reaching only 3°C (37°F).
- The lowest overnight temperature recorded in June was -5°C (23°F) (June 1, 2000).

What to Wear in Banff in June
Pack for changing conditions in Banff in June. Bring a mix of short and long sleeves, a warm layer like a hoodie or light jacket, and comfortable pants. The key is being able to add or remove layers as the days goes by. Prepare for significant rainfall with proper waterproof clothing and shoes. You'll definitely want to pack sunglasses and sunscreen.
